Small cleanup
This commit is contained in:
parent
17f9328c8a
commit
07d3932bdc
4 changed files with 4 additions and 15 deletions
|
|
@ -80,7 +80,7 @@ public class PersonController : BaseApiController
|
||||||
/// <param name="userParams"></param>
|
/// <param name="userParams"></param>
|
||||||
/// <returns></returns>
|
/// <returns></returns>
|
||||||
[HttpPost("all")]
|
[HttpPost("all")]
|
||||||
public async Task<ActionResult<PagedList<BrowsePersonDto>>> GetAuthorsForBrowse(BrowsePersonFilterDto filter, [FromQuery] UserParams? userParams)
|
public async Task<ActionResult<PagedList<BrowsePersonDto>>> GetPeopleForBrowse(BrowsePersonFilterDto filter, [FromQuery] UserParams? userParams)
|
||||||
{
|
{
|
||||||
userParams ??= UserParams.Default;
|
userParams ??= UserParams.Default;
|
||||||
|
|
||||||
|
|
@ -90,17 +90,6 @@ public class PersonController : BaseApiController
|
||||||
return Ok(list);
|
return Ok(list);
|
||||||
}
|
}
|
||||||
|
|
||||||
// [HttpPost("all-v2")]
|
|
||||||
// public async Task<ActionResult<PagedList<BrowsePersonDto>>> GetAuthorsForBrowse(FilterV2Dto filter, [FromQuery] UserParams? userParams)
|
|
||||||
// {
|
|
||||||
// userParams ??= UserParams.Default;
|
|
||||||
//
|
|
||||||
// // var list = await _unitOfWork.PersonRepository.GetBrowsePersonDtos(User.GetUserId(), filter, userParams);
|
|
||||||
// // Response.AddPaginationHeader(list.CurrentPage, list.PageSize, list.TotalCount, list.TotalPages);
|
|
||||||
//
|
|
||||||
// return Ok([]);
|
|
||||||
// }
|
|
||||||
|
|
||||||
/// <summary>
|
/// <summary>
|
||||||
/// Updates the Person
|
/// Updates the Person
|
||||||
/// </summary>
|
/// </summary>
|
||||||
|
|
|
||||||
|
|
@ -267,7 +267,7 @@ public class PersonRepository : IPersonRepository
|
||||||
PersonFilterField.Role => query.HasPersonRole(true, statement.Comparison, (IList<PersonRole>)value),
|
PersonFilterField.Role => query.HasPersonRole(true, statement.Comparison, (IList<PersonRole>)value),
|
||||||
PersonFilterField.SeriesCount => query.HasPersonSeriesCount(true, statement.Comparison, (int)value),
|
PersonFilterField.SeriesCount => query.HasPersonSeriesCount(true, statement.Comparison, (int)value),
|
||||||
PersonFilterField.ChapterCount => query.HasPersonChapterCount(true, statement.Comparison, (int)value),
|
PersonFilterField.ChapterCount => query.HasPersonChapterCount(true, statement.Comparison, (int)value),
|
||||||
_ => throw new ArgumentOutOfRangeException()
|
_ => throw new ArgumentOutOfRangeException(nameof(statement.Field), $"Unexpected value for field: {statement.Field}")
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-1290,7 +1290,7 @@ public class SeriesRepository : ISeriesRepository
|
||||||
FilterField.ReadingDate => query.HasReadingDate(true, statement.Comparison, (DateTime) value, userId),
|
FilterField.ReadingDate => query.HasReadingDate(true, statement.Comparison, (DateTime) value, userId),
|
||||||
FilterField.ReadLast => query.HasReadLast(true, statement.Comparison, (int) value, userId),
|
FilterField.ReadLast => query.HasReadLast(true, statement.Comparison, (int) value, userId),
|
||||||
FilterField.AverageRating => query.HasAverageRating(true, statement.Comparison, (float) value),
|
FilterField.AverageRating => query.HasAverageRating(true, statement.Comparison, (float) value),
|
||||||
_ => throw new ArgumentOutOfRangeException()
|
_ => throw new ArgumentOutOfRangeException(nameof(statement.Field), $"Unexpected value for field: {statement.Field}")
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-22,7 +22,7 @@ public static class PersonFilterFieldValueConverter
|
||||||
|
|
||||||
private static IList<PersonRole> ParsePersonRoles(string value)
|
private static IList<PersonRole> ParsePersonRoles(string value)
|
||||||
{
|
{
|
||||||
if (string.IsNullOrEmpty(value)) return new List<PersonRole>();
|
if (string.IsNullOrEmpty(value)) return [];
|
||||||
|
|
||||||
return value.Split(',', StringSplitOptions.RemoveEmptyEntries)
|
return value.Split(',', StringSplitOptions.RemoveEmptyEntries)
|
||||||
.Select(v => Enum.Parse<PersonRole>(v.Trim()))
|
.Select(v => Enum.Parse<PersonRole>(v.Trim()))
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ue